Tip: When Recipe Approvals are disabled, the Release Recipe as Step and Release Recipe
to Production checkboxes display the state of these properties, but are inactive. These
properties are set in the Recipe > Header Data dialog box.
When Recipe Approvals are enabled, these properties are treated as two steps in the
approval process, and are set as part of the approval signoff process.
When Release Recipe as Step is true (box is checked), the recipe can be used by other
recipes. When Release Recipe to Production is true, the recipe is shown in the Recipe List
in FactoryTalk Batch View, eProcedure, and ActiveX Controls. This allows batches to be
created from the recipe.
The ISA S88.01 recipe structure of CLS_FRENCHVANILLA is displayed on the
left side in the Procedure View pane. The SFC version of the
CLS_FRENCHVANILLA recipe structure is displayed on the right side in the
Recipe Construction pane.
